Kadron Boone (born September 13, 1991) is a Canadian football wide receiver for the Saskatchewan Roughriders of the Canadian Football League (CFL). He played college football at LSU.

Professional career

On May 10, 2014, Boone signed with the Philadelphia Eagles as an undrafted free agent. He was released on August 23, 2014, and was then signed to the St. Louis Rams practice squad on October 21. The Rams cut Boone on October 29, and the Indianapolis Colts signed him to their practice squad on December 31, 2014.

On May 9, 2016 Boone signed with the New York Giants. On August 30, 2016, he was waived by the Giants.

Boone was signed to the Saskatchewan Roughriders' practice roster on October 25, 2016. He was promoted to the active roster on October 28, 2016.
